Agua Blanca outside of Puerto Lopèz was rather cool, we saw some pre-Incan runes and swam in this Volcano-water lake that reeked of hydrogen sulfide (but I think at the levels at which you can smell it it´s not too dangerous). It was a strange place though, it was 5 miles off the highway but the road was treacherous and looked like it wasn´t really headed anywhere cool. Then suddenly a tourist town appeared, though it wasn´t so wealthy that the livestock were restrained or a menu could be found. It was just a very odd place, it´s difficult to describe, but I did enjoy scouting out the ruins. These were essentially rock foundations of the longhouses that the civilization before the Incans used. There were also some tombs, which are big clay pots like you might plant geraniums in but they have skeletons in the fetal position with their most prized possessions (aka fancy conch shells and gold. They believed these 2 things to be equally valuable which the Spanish found extremely confusing when they arrived).
